0

完结 【图灵课堂】Java高级开发工程师

分合格后
23天前 19

下课仔:xingkeit.top/7760/


在软件工程领域,技术的迭代速度往往快于个体的成长周期。对于许多 Java 开发者而言,从初级迈向高级的瓶颈,不在于语法糖的熟练程度,而在于对底层技术原理的掌控力。图灵课堂推出的 Java 高级开发工程师课程,之所以被视为职场进阶的捷径,并非因为其传授了某种速成的秘籍,而是因为它精准地切中了现代软件技术的核心脉络,对开发者的技术知识体系进行了从应用层到底层原理的深度重构。

一、 JVM 深度剖析:跨越性能优化的鸿沟

Java 程序员的高级进阶,第一道门槛便是 Java 虚拟机(JVM)。在传统的初级开发视角下,内存只是一个抽象的概念,垃圾回收(GC)是不可见的黑盒。然而,图灵课堂的课程视角直接深入到字节码层面,揭示了内存管理的物理本质。

通过对 JVM 内存模型、垃圾回收算法(G1、ZGC)以及类加载机制的深度拆解,课程帮助开发者建立了“上帝视角”。这种技术洞察力的提升,使得开发者在面对线上 OOM(内存溢出)或 CPU 飙升等复杂故障时,不再依赖盲目的试错,而是能够通过分析内存快照和线程堆栈,精准定位问题根源。这种基于底层原理的排错能力,是区分码农与架构师的技术分水岭,也是高并发系统稳定运行的基石。

二、 并发编程内核:突破高并发的技术壁垒

随着摩尔定律的放缓,单核性能的提升遭遇物理瓶颈,分布式与并发成为提升系统算力的唯一途径。图灵课堂课程的一大亮点,在于对 Java 并发编程(JUC)内核的深度挖掘。

课程并未止步于如何使用锁或线程池,而是深入到了硬件层面的内存屏障、指令重排以及操作系统层面的线程调度。通过对 volatile 关键字底层实现、AQS(AbstractQueuedSynchronizer)核心源码的解析,课程揭示了高并发场景下数据一致性与线程安全的技术真相。这种对并发底层机制的掌握,使得开发者能够设计出在极端高负载下依然优雅、无锁或低锁的高性能系统。在微服务架构盛行的今天,这种底层的并发掌控力是构建高吞吐量分布式系统的核心科技竞争力。

三、 分布式架构演进:构建高可用系统的工程哲学

现代 Java 开发早已超越了单机应用的范畴,转向了复杂的分布式系统。图灵课堂的课程紧跟技术前沿,详细拆解了分布式系统中的核心挑战与解决方案。

从 CAP 理论到 BASE 理论,从分布式一致性协议到高可用集群的容灾设计,课程将零散的技术组件串联成一套严密的工程哲学。通过对分布式事务、服务治理、消息队列等技术的深度剖析,课程不仅传授了“怎么做”,更重要的是解释了“为什么”。这种架构思维的训练,使得开发者在面对复杂的业务场景时,能够跳出代码细节,站在系统架构的高度进行技术选型和容量规划。这种宏观的技术视野,是高级开发工程师向技术专家转型的关键。

四、 结语:技术深度的复利效应

图灵课堂 Java 高级开发工程师课程所揭示的“捷径”,实际上是一条回归技术本质的道路。在 AI 辅助编程日益普及的今天,简单的代码生成已不再稀缺,稀缺的是对技术原理的深刻洞察力和解决复杂工程问题的能力。

通过 JVM、并发编程与分布式架构的深度洗礼,开发者构建起了一套难以被替代的技术知识体系。这种基于底层原理的扎实功底,具有极强的技术复利效应——它不仅能帮助开发者从容应对当前的技术挑战,更能使他们在未来的技术变革中,以不变应万变,始终站在技术浪潮的前沿。这就是科技时代,职场进阶的终极捷径。



本站不存储任何实质资源,该帖为网盘用户发布的网盘链接介绍帖,本文内所有链接指向的云盘网盘资源,其版权归版权方所有!其实际管理权为帖子发布者所有,本站无法操作相关资源。如您认为本站任何介绍帖侵犯了您的合法版权,请发送邮件 [email protected] 进行投诉,我们将在确认本文链接指向的资源存在侵权后,立即删除相关介绍帖子!
最新回复 (0)

    暂无评论

请先登录后发表评论!

返回
请先登录后发表评论!